'무정전 전원 공급장치 (UPS)'에 해당되는 글 1건



  1. 2014.05.09 | 하드웨어 제어

하드웨어 제어

Study | 2014. 5. 9. 19:29
Posted by Brilliant Idea

반응형

하드웨어 제어에 대해 알아봅니다.

 

I. 중앙처리장치를 위한 기능

  1) 인터럽트 (INTERRUPT)

     프로그램을 실행하는 도중에 예기치 않은 상황이 발생할 경우 현재 실행중인 작업을 일시 중단하고, 발생된 상황을 우선 처리한 후 실행중이던 작업으로 복귀하여 계속 처리하는 것을 말합니다. 인터럽트에는 외부인터럽트, 내부 인터럽트, 소프트웨어 인터럽트가 있습니다.

   외부인터럽트는 입출력장치가 데이터의 전송을 요구하거나 전송이 끝났음을 알릴경우, 특정 장치에 할당된 작업시간이 끝났을 경우, 컴퓨터의 전원공급이 끊어졌을 경우입니다.

   내부 인터럽트는 명령처리중 오버플로(OVERFLOW) 또는 언더플로(Underflow)가 발생하였을 경우, 0으로 나누는 명령이 수행될 경우입니다.

   소프트웨어 인터럽트는 운영체제의 감시 프로그램을 호출하는 SVC(Supervisor call) 인터럽트가 있습니다.

  2) 채널(CHANNEL)

      주변장치에 대한 제어권한을 CPU로부터 넘겨 받아 CPU 대신 입출력을 관리하는 것으로 채널의 작동으로 CPU는 컴퓨터 시스템 전체의 처리 성능을 향상시킬 수 있습니다.

3) DMA (Direct Memory Access - 직접 메모리 접근)

      CPU 의 참여없이 입출력장치와 메모리가 직접 데이터를 주고 받는 것으로 CPU의 처리 양을 줄이고 다른 작업을 처리할 수 있게 함으로써 컴퓨터의 성능을 높이는 방법중의 하나입니다.

4) 듀얼 시스템 (Dual System)

      업무처리의 신뢰도를 높이기 위해 동일한 컴퓨터 두대를 병렬로 설치하는 시스템으로 2개의 CPU는 같은 업무를 동시에 처리하며 그 결과를 상호 점검하면서 운영하다가 한쪽이 정지되면 다른 컴퓨터가 계속하여 처리하여 업무중단을 방지하게 됩니다.

5) IRQ (Interrupt ReQuest, 인터럽트 요청값)

      컴퓨터를 구성하는 각 장치들은 CPU에게 인터럽트를 요청할때 CPU가 각 장치를 구분할 수 있는 고유한 IRQ가 있습니다. CPU는 각 장치에서 발생하는 IRQ를 확인한 후 우선순위가 가장 높은 장치에게 먼저 인터럽트를 허용하게 됩니다. 만약, IRQ가 동일한 하드웨어가 있으면 충돌이 발생하여 두 장치 모두 사용할 수 없게 됩니다.

6) 다중 프로그래밍 (Multi-Programming)

      하나의 프로세서에 두개이상의 프로그램을 동시에 실행하는 방식(시분할 기법사용)

7) 다중 프로세싱(Multi - Processing)

      하나의 컴퓨터에 여러개의 프로세서를 사용하는 방식으로 처리속도가 향상된다.    

II. 메인보드 (주기판)

  1) 메인보드 (Main board)

      마더보드 혹은 주기판이라 불리며, CPU와 각종 장치를 연결할 수 있으며, PC에 사용되는 주변기기를 연결하고 데이터를 전송하는 역할을 합니다.

  2) 버스 (BUS)

      컴퓨터에서 데이터를 주고받는 통로로, 사용용도에 따라 내부 버스와 외부 버스, 그리고 확장 버스로 구분합니다.

  3) RAM 소켓

      RAM 을 장착하는 소켓으로 램을 2개 단위로 꽂을수 있는 SIMM소켓과 낱개로 꽂을수 있는 DIMM 소캣으로 구분됩니다. 모듈 램의 규격에 따라 32핀, 72핀, 168핀 이 있으며, 근래의 제품은 168핀 램을 많이 사용합니다.

  4) 확장버스 / 확장슬롯

      확장버스는 메인보드에서 지원하는 기능 외에 다른 기능을 지원하는 장치를 연결하는 부분으로 끼울수 있는 슬롯 형태이기때문에 확장 슬롯이라고 합니다. 그래픽카드, LAN 카드, 모뎀 등을 끼울 때 사용합니다.

  5) 포트(Port)

      메인보드에 주변장치를 연결하기위한 접속부분으로 최근에는 USB를 많이 사용합니다.

<접속 방식에 따른 구분> 

      컴퓨터의 기본 입출력장치나 메모리 등 하드웨어 작동에 필요한 명령을 모아놓은 프로그램입니다. 전원이 켜지면 POST (Power On Self Test)를 통해 컴퓨터를 점검한 후 사용 간으한 장치들을 초기화 합니다. 최근의 바이오스는 플래시 롬에 저장되므로 칩을 교환하지 않고도 바이오스를 업그레이드 할 수 있습니다. 바이오스는 ROM에 저장되어 있어 ROM-BIOS라고도 합니다. 바이오스는 하드웨어와 소프트 웨어의 중간형태로 펌웨어라고 합니다. CMOS에서 설정가능한 항목은 시스템의 날짜와 시간, 하드디스크 타입, 부팅순서, 칩셋설정, 전원관리 PnP 설정, 시스템 암호 설정, Anti-Virus 기능등입니다. 여기서 CMOS 란 자주 갱신을 하는 컴퓨터의 중요자료들을 보관하는 RAM의 일종으로 CMOS에 연결된 SETUP 명령어는 ROM-BIOS에 수록되어 있습니다.

 

  7) 칩셋 (Chipset)

      CPU, 메모리 그리고 시스템 버스 사이의 데이터 호름을 제어합니다. 메모리의 ECC(에러정정기능) 의 지원 여부와 설치할 수 있는 최대 크기를 결정합니다.

III. PC관리

   1) 시스템 관리

      컴퓨터를 켤때는 주변기기를 먼저 켜고 본체를 나중에 켜지만, 끌때는 본체를 먼저 끕니다.

      컴퓨터를 이동하거나 부품을 교체할 때는 반드시 전원을 끄고 작업합니다.

      전원을 끌때에는 반드시 사용중인 프로그램을 먼저 종료합니다.

      정기적으로 최신 백신프로그램을 사용하여 바이러스 감염을 방지합니다.

    ※ 전원관리장치 - 정전, 전압의 불안정 등에 대비하여 사용하는 장치입니다.   

 2) 저장매체 관리

      컴퓨터 성능향상을 위해 주기적으로 디스크정리, 디스크검사, 디스크 조각모음, 백업실행을 합니다.

      하드 디스크는 적당한 공기순환유지로 과열 및 충격에 주의합니다.

      플로피디스크는 노출된 표면을 손으로 만지거나 이물질이 들어가지 않도록 주의합니다.

      강한 자성물질을 자기 저장 매체(하드디스크, 플로피디스크, 자기테이프등) 주위에 놓지 않습니다.

 3) 응급처치

     ① 부팅이 안되는 경우

      - 전원 케이블의 연결상태를 확인, 파워 서플라이의 동장 유무를 확인, 메인보드의 전원공급 여부를 확인합니다.

      - A 드라이브(플로피드라이브) 확인, 하드디스크로 부팅이 안되는 경우에는 시스템 파일을 복사한 뒤에 재부팅, 디스크 드라이브 자체가 불량일 때에는 A/S 요청 합니다.

      - 최신 버전의 백신 프로그램으로 점검 및 치료, 하드디스크가 느려졌다면 디스크 조각모음을 실행 합니다.

    ② 하드디스크 문제

      - CMOS Set up 에서 하드디스크의 타입을 Auto Detection으로 설정하거나 하드디스크 표면에 기록된 실린더/섹터수를 정확하게 입력합니다.

    ③ 모니더의 문제 : 모니터 케이블의 연결 여부를 확인, 그래픽 카드의 청결상태나 접속여부를 확인 합니다.

IV. PC 업그레이

 1) 업그레이드

      컴퓨터의 하드웨어나 소프트웨어를 일부 교체하거나 추가하여 컴퓨터 시스템의 성능을 향상시키는 작업을 말합니다.

  2) 소프트웨어 업그레이드

      소프트웨어 업그레이드는 기존 소프트웨어의 버그를 수정하거나 새로운 기능을 추가한 새 버전의 소프트웨어를 구입하거나 통신망에서 다운로드하여 시스템에 설치하는 것을 말합니다.

  3) 하드웨어 업그레이드

      CPU 업그레이드, RAM 업그레이드, 하드디스크 (HDO) 업그레이드, CD-ROM 드라이브 업그레이드 가 있습니다.

     ① CPU 업그레이드 : 펜티엄 3나 펜티엄 4 CPU는 메인보드에서 지원여부를 반드시 확인한 후 기존의 메인보드가 지원하지 않을 경우 함께 교체해야 합니다. CPU는 기종에 따라 핀의 수나 크기가 다르므로, 핀이나 슬롯의 극성(전극의 양극과 음극)을 꼭 맞춰야 합니다.

     ② RAM 업그레이드 : 램은 접근 속도의 단위인 ns(나노초) 의 수치가 작을 수록 좋습니다.램 업그레이드를 할떄는 램의 형태(딥램, 모듈램) 속도, 핀수(32핀, 72핀, 168핀), 용량, 꽂을 자리, 그리고 메인 보드에서 지원하느 메모리의 최대 크기등을 정확히 확인한 후, 추가해야 합니다.

     ③  하드디스크 업그레이드 : 하드디스크는 용량과 RPM 의 수치가 크고, 전송 속도의 단위인 ms(밀리초) 가 작은 것이 좋습니다. 하드디스크의 연결방식인 IDE, EIDE, SCSI를 확인해야 하며, UDMA 33/66/100을 지원하는 성능 좋은 제품들은 메인보드에서 지원을 해야 정상적인 속도가 나오므로 메인보드 지원여부를 확인해야 합니다.

     ④ CD-ROM 드라이브 업그레이드 : CD-ROM 드라이브는 전송 속도에 따라 8배속, 16배속, 32배속 등으로 나타납니다. 12배속이하의 CD-ROM 드라이브는 대부분 멀티리드기능이 없어 CD-RW 와 일부 CD-R 미디어를 인식하지 못하므로 업그레이드를 고려해야 합니다. 배속은 초당 150KB를 전송하는 것을 의미합니다.

4) 업그레이드 시 고려할 사항

     ① 업그레이드 시 수치가 클수록 좋은 하드웨어

        - CPU 클럭속도 : MHz 또는 GHz

        - CPU의 성능 :MIPS

        - 모뎀의 전송속도 : bps 또는 cps

        - CD-ROM 드라이브 전송 속도 : 배속

        - 하드디스크 용량 : GB

        - 하드디스크 회전수 : RPM

    ② 수치가 작을수록 좋은 것

       - RAM 접근 속도 : ns

       - 하드디스크 접근 속도 : ms

 ※ VDT 증후군 : (Video Display Terminal) 증후군이란 컴퓨터를 장시간 다루는 직업에 종사하는 사람들에게 나타나는 병으로 증상은 두통, 시력저하, 스트레스, 빈혈, 유산 등으로 나타나는 증상을 말합니다.

출처 : EBS 컴퓨터 활용 능력 1급 필기 박길식 교수님 강의

반응형
 

블로그 이미지

Brilliant Idea

Introduce Korean actors and actresses in Korean Drama.

카테고리

분류 전체보기 (261)
The joy of life (160)
Study (99)